Chicago White Sox pitcher David Sandlin gets a promising update

Paul Janish, the team’s Director of Player Development, spoke to the media and explained David Sandlin’s status. He would mention that Sandlin is throwing off the mound now, but there is no timetable for him to be available to pitch in a game. Sandlin has been dealing with back and right elbow issues throughout Spring Training, but it appears he is getting closer to a return. He expanded on this as well:

“We’ll probably take it easy with him in terms of the build-up. All signs are pointing up. I wouldn’t feel totally comfortable sharing the exact timeline just yet. He is doing well relative to a little speed bump.”

Sandlin is the 18th-ranked prospect in the White Sox organization and has not appeared in a Spring Training game this season. He had a rough stretch in Triple-A last season as he pitched as a reliever. In 15 games (one start), he was 4-2 with a 7.61 ERA and a .337 batting average against in 23.2 innings. Sandlin struggled with his command and needs to show significant improvement if he wants to be considered for a call-up this season. It will be intriguing to follow Sandlin’s status and see how he does when he is able to pitch in Triple-A Charlotte.
